Arsenal’s U18s side bizarrely saw their Saturday fixture postponed as their team coach reportedly drove to the wrong destination. The Gunners’ youth side, led by academy graduate Jack Wilshere, are currently 7th in the south section of the U18 Premier League. Wilshere and his young Arsenal side have seen their next game postponedGetty An away trip to Brighton was scheduled this weekend as they eyed a fourth win in the league. However, they will have to wait a little longer to face the Seagulls as reports say the team coach travelled to Bournemouth instead. Kick-off was due to take place at 12pm and was then delayed by half an hour, before being postponed fully after the error.
